# Cellular Defense System
The most immediate and far-reaching impact of consuming eggplant relates to its remarkable antioxidant content, which directly benefits the health of every cell lining and structure within the body. [4] These antioxidants are crucial for protecting the body’s cells from being damaged by unstable molecules called free radicals, which contribute to oxidative stress and drive disease development. [2][6]
The vibrant, deep purple hue of the most common varieties is actually a visible indicator of its key protective components: anthocyanins. [2][4] Specifically, an anthocyanin called nasunin is present and has been shown in studies to offer protection against the oxidative damage that accompanies aging. [4] Nasunin’s influence is not just broad-spectrum; it appears to specifically safeguard the fat layer of cell membranes, helping to maintain their structural integrity and prevent cell death or potential DNA mutation. [6] Furthermore, eggplant contains other beneficial plant compounds, including polyphenols and various phenolic acids. [4][6] One such acid, chlorogenic acid, is noted for its ability to combat free radicals that might lead to tumor growth. [6]
# Brain Function
This powerful antioxidant activity extends critically to the brain. Eggplants are a source of nasunin, which is recognized for reducing inflammation within the brain tissue. [8] Beyond reducing inflammation, nasunin’s protective action on cell membranes is relevant to cognitive health, as it helps maintain the structural basis for nerve cells to communicate effectively across synapses. By reducing oxidative stress and inflammation, compounds in eggplant may offer protection against neurodegenerative disorders, such as Alzheimer’s disease, which is the most common form of dementia. [8] This connection highlights the eggplant’s role in supporting the central nervous system by maintaining the resilience of its delicate cell structures. [6][8]
# Cardiovascular System Support
The wellness benefits of eggplant significantly target the heart and blood vessels, which rely heavily on balanced pressure and healthy lipid profiles to function optimally. [6]
The same anthocyanins that shield cells elsewhere also appear to play a role in heart health by helping to reduce inflammatory markers that elevate the risk of heart disease, according to some research. [4] A more direct mechanism involves blood pressure regulation. Nasunin is linked to the dilation of blood vessels by activating nitric oxide, a pathway that is further enhanced by chlorogenic acid also found in the skin. Additionally, some compounds in the pulp of eggplants, even the white varieties, exhibit activity similar to ACE inhibitors—enzymes central to blood pressure management—offering another route to stress reduction on the heart.
Maintaining healthy cholesterol levels is another cornerstone of cardiovascular wellness, and eggplant contributes here as well. Some animal studies suggest that dietary eggplant can lead to a reduction in LDL cholesterol (the so-called "bad" cholesterol) while simultaneously encouraging the uptake of HDL cholesterol ("good" cholesterol"). [6] High levels of LDL are implicated in atherosclerosis, the hardening of the arteries that increases the risk of strokes and heart attacks. [6] Furthermore, the presence of potassium, an essential electrolyte, supports proper heart rhythm, muscle contraction, and nerve signaling throughout the body. [5][8]
# Digestive Tract Health
When considering the gastrointestinal tract, eggplant excels due to its high content of both fiber and water. [2][6] A single cup of cooked eggplant can supply between 2 to 3 grams of dietary fiber. [2] Fiber is foundational for digestive regularity, aiding in smooth bowel movements and contributing to overall gut health. [2][7] For individuals experiencing constipation, which can be a side effect of certain medications, ensuring adequate fiber intake from foods like eggplant can be a simple, proactive step toward maintaining regularity. [7] The fiber works by passing through the digestive system relatively intact, adding necessary bulk to stools. [4]
Beyond fiber, the eggplant’s high water content—often exceeding 90 percent—is vital for keeping the digestive tract adequately hydrated. [6] This hydration is necessary for the efficient elimination of waste and toxins through the intestines. [6] This combination of water and fiber makes eggplant a beneficial inclusion in specialized eating plans, such as the GAPS diet, which aims to correct digestive issues and reduce inflammation. [6] If you are focusing on weight management, this high water and fiber content works synergistically to promote feelings of fullness and satiety, which can naturally reduce overall calorie consumption throughout the day. [4][8]
An important consideration for those closely monitoring kidney function is that eggplant, like many plants, contains oxalates. [8] While the amounts may not be excessively high compared to other vegetables, individuals with a history of calcium oxalate kidney stones might choose to moderate their intake or employ specific cooking methods, such as boiling, which can help reduce oxalate levels in the final dish.
# Metabolic and Endocrine Balance
The eggplant’s profile also offers advantages for maintaining metabolic equilibrium, influencing how the body manages sugar and weight, thus providing support to the pancreas and metabolic processes. [4][6]
The presence of substantial fiber helps in controlling blood sugar. Fiber slows down the rate at which sugar is digested and absorbed into the bloodstream, which prevents rapid spikes and subsequent crashes in blood sugar levels. [4][8] Additionally, research suggests that polyphenols found in eggplant might reduce sugar absorption while potentially increasing the body’s secretion of insulin, mechanisms that contribute to lower overall blood sugar. [4] Because of these factors, eggplant aligns well with dietary guidelines for managing Type 2 Diabetes, which emphasize high-fiber whole grains and vegetables. [4]
The mineral manganese is also present, contributing about 5 to 10 percent of the daily requirement in a single cup serving. [2][6][8] Manganese is critical for metabolic activity, plays a role in carbohydrate, cholesterol, and glucose breakdown, and is necessary for the enzyme reactions that drive metabolism. [6][8] Furthermore, it supports optimal thyroid gland function, a key component of metabolic regulation. [6]
# Liver Function and Detoxification
The body’s primary processing center, the liver, benefits notably from eggplant's unique compounds, particularly in the realm of detoxification. [6] As a natural chelator, the antioxidant nasunin can bind to harmful heavy metal agents such as mercury, arsenic, and lead, effectively neutralizing them so they can be transported out of the body. [6] This chelating action is beneficial because heavy metal accumulation is a significant source of dangerous free radicals that can overburden the liver and exacerbate stress responses. [6] Furthermore, laboratory investigations have indicated that eggplant can activate certain enzymes within the body that specifically assist in detoxifying and removing drugs and other toxic chemical substances. [6]
It is worth noting that while iron is vital for immune health and oxygen transport, too much iron—iron overload—is detrimental, increasing free radicals and potentially raising the risk for heart disease and cancer. By binding excess iron, nasunin in eggplant helps the body maintain a crucial balance of this essential mineral [6].
# Bone and Blood Support
Eggplant's nutritional composition offers specific advantages for the skeletal system and the hematopoietic system (blood formation).
For bone health, manganese is a co-factor in mineralization processes. [6] It is necessary for the proper utilization of calcium, and it aids in the creation of important enzymes required to build stronger bone structures. [6]
In terms of blood quality, eggplant contains both iron and copper. [6] Iron deficiency can lead to anemia, presenting symptoms like persistent fatigue, headaches, and general weakness. [6] Copper is necessary for red blood cell production, and without both minerals, hemoglobin counts can suffer. [6] Additionally, Vitamin B6, found in eggplant, is involved in metabolism and plays a role in the body's ability to produce antibodies, which are critical cells for a functioning immune system. [2]
# Cautions and Culinary Considerations
While the systemic benefits are numerous, a balanced view requires acknowledging potential drawbacks and selecting the produce wisely. [5][8] Because eggplant is a nightshade, some individuals with inflammatory conditions like arthritis report flare-ups upon consumption, often attributed anecdotally to alkaloids like solanine, although solid, controlled evidence confirming this link is currently lacking. [5][8] If a personal negative reaction occurs, avoidance is the sensible course. [5]
# Selection and Preparation Tips
Selecting the best eggplant involves more than just picking the biggest one. Smaller eggplants generally possess fewer seeds and, consequently, a less bitter taste. [3][6] You are looking for a specimen with skin that is shiny, smooth, and firm, that yields just slightly when squeezed, and has a green stem, signaling freshness. [3][7] Avoid anything wrinkled, which indicates dehydration. [3][7]
The preparation method significantly dictates the final nutritional contribution, especially regarding fat and calories. [5] Eggplant’s spongy texture readily absorbs liquids, meaning frying dramatically increases caloric density. [5] To maximize the benefits, especially fiber retention, grilling, baking, or roasting are preferred methods. [3][6][7]
A practical method to manage flavor before cooking is to address the bitterness directly. The indentation at the base, often called the "belly button," can give a clue to the internal seed count and bitterness level. When purchasing the common Globe variety, observing which ones have the shallowest indentations can pre-select for a milder flavor profile, potentially reducing the need for extensive pre-treatment.
To draw out moisture and reduce the inherent bitterness—a process that also helps the flesh absorb less oil during subsequent cooking—sprinkling the cut pieces liberally with salt and letting them rest for about 30 minutes is a traditional technique. [2][5] After resting, the salt must be thoroughly rinsed away before cooking. [2][5] To achieve maximum crispness when roasting or baking, switching the oven to the broil setting briefly at the end can give the surface a pleasing golden-brown crunch. [2]
Given that eggplant is over 90% water, its fiber density per raw weight is relatively low compared to denser vegetables. For readers focused on maximizing fiber intake per meal portion without adding excessive liquid, preparing eggplant by roasting or baking until much of the internal moisture has evaporated concentrates the existing fiber and nutrients, making it a more nutrient-dense component in a grain bowl or salad topping compared to a boiled preparation.
